A light drizzle doesn't make much difference to the deer as far as feeding and browsing that I can tell. Let the rain set in hard and the deer will most likely lay down, at least that has been my experience. If I am gonna stick it out during a steady down pour I will be on the ground slipping looking for deer laying down. If your prepared for it can still be a lot of fun.
